One of the most common challenges is the integration of legacy systems. Many companies already use tools such as SAP, Odoo, or Salesforce for expense and human resources management. Instead of replacing these platforms, a smart approach consists of extending their capabilities through AWS and Azure cloud services, creating APIs and connectors that synchronize information in real time. This allows employees to request a trip from the intranet, the system to verify availability in the ERP, the manager to approve with a click, and the data to be automatically reflected in accounting. Furthermore, the use of AI agents can handle routing requests according to predefined business rules, notifying those involved and even generating expense reports without manual intervention.

But automation makes no sense if the platform is not secure. Travel management involves personal data, corporate budgets, and sometimes information about employee locations. Here, cybersecurity plays a fundamental role. Q2BSTUDIO incorporates role-based access controls, audit logging, GDPR compliance, and, when artificial intelligence models connected to on-premise systems are used, establishes VPN tunnels and private endpoints in Azure to ensure that data never leaves the corporate perimeter. This level of protection is especially relevant in implementations that use RAG (Retrieval-Augmented Generation) or private language models.

Another aspect that makes a difference is the ability to measure the real impact of the project. It is not enough to launch the intranet; one must observe how it improves cycle times, reduces operational costs, and frees teams from manual work. With a unified dashboard, leaders can view in real time the status of each request, bottlenecks, and performance metrics. This is where business intelligence services and tools such as Power BI come into play, allowing the intranet data to be transformed into actionable insights.
